Position Summary

The Administrative Assistant position provides administrative support to the PCHAS Counseling Center in Waxahachie. Primary responsibilities include entering and maintaining client information in the program’s management information system, supporting marketing and community outreach efforts, maintaining and organizing client case records, filing, preparing and printing reports, and assisting with general office operations. Additional duties may include copying, labeling, mailing, organizing materials, and other administrative tasks as assigned.

Core Responsibilities

  • Provides clerical support to the Counseling Center Supervisor and staff, including generating letters, memos, reports, etc.
  • Assists all staff in retrieving documentation from files, copying, faxing and mailing information.
  • Makes phone calls on behalf of staff as needed in the process of task completion and other program operational requirements.
  • Collections and files all material related to the Counseling Center on a weekly basis.
  • Creates, organizes and maintains all client records as needed. This includes entering information into the PCHAS data management system.
  • Manages archives of files.
  • Provides all receptionist responsibilities. Welcomes guests as needed.
  • Takes messages and directs phone calls to the appropriate staff person.
  • Telephone messages must be handled discreetly in order to ensure client confidentiality.
  • Receives RSVPs for meetings and trainings.
  • Requests office and kitchen supplies as needed.
  • Ensures that all office equipment is in good working order.
  • Responsible for accounting that must be reported to the Central Office.
  • Oversees outgoing and incoming mail. Responsible for correct postage on outgoing mail and securing online postage. Responsible for distribution of incoming mail, giving appropriate attention to any monies received in mail.
  • Verifies client insurance for claims.

Working Conditions

The Administrative Assistant works primarily from the office in a varying schedule as dictated by the current needs of the program and authorized by the DFW Regional Director. The environment is shared workspace with access to a computer workstation, fax machine, copier, and telephone. The work environment is subject to mild stress. Work hours typically fall within typical weekday business hours. Occasional local travel to run errands using employee’s own vehicle. Hours will be determined based on the need of the counseling center.
